Lina Fontaine
১৮ নভেম্বর ২০২৪
TypeScript: Enum বৈধকরণের সাথে রিটার্ন টাইপ সীমাবদ্ধতা প্রয়োগ করা

TypeScript-এ কঠোর টাইপ চেকগুলি অপ্রত্যাশিত ত্রুটিগুলি এড়াতে সাহায্য করতে পারে, বিশেষ করে যখন API উত্তরগুলির সাথে কাজ করে যা নির্দিষ্ট ডেটা কাঠামোর জন্য কল করে৷ কাস্টম প্রকার এবং ScopeType এর মতো enums ব্যবহার করে ভুলবশত অতিরিক্ত বৈশিষ্ট্য প্রদান করা হলে বিকাশকারীরা সুনির্দিষ্ট রিটার্নের ধরন প্রয়োগ করতে পারে এবং ত্রুটিগুলি লক্ষ্য করতে পারে৷ এই পদ্ধতিটি প্রতিটি প্রতিক্রিয়াকে তার সুযোগ অনুসারে যাচাই করতে সাহায্য করে, তা একটি তালিকা বা জেনেরিক প্রকার, যা জটিল অ্যাপ্লিকেশন পরিচালনার জন্য দরকারী। কোডের স্থায়িত্ব বাড়ানোর পাশাপাশি, কঠোর ধরনের প্রয়োগ আপনার অ্যাপ্লিকেশনের গঠন এবং স্বচ্ছতা সামঞ্জস্যপূর্ণ রাখতে সাহায্য করে।